Projekt

Allgemein

Profil

Aktionen

GX-Abgewiesen #67973

geschlossen

Gutschein E-Mail schneidet Cent-Beträge ab | Gift vouchers cuts of cent amounts

Von Jan-Olof Kratzke vor fast 4 Jahren hinzugefügt. Vor etwa 3 Jahren aktualisiert.

Status:
Abgewiesen
Priorität:
Normal
Zugewiesen an:
-
Kategorie:
Gutscheine
Zielversion:
-
Beginn:
Abgabedatum:
% erledigt:

0%

Geschätzter Aufwand:
Steps to reproduce:
Release Notes Langtext:

Beschreibung

Beim Versenden von Gutschein E-Mails werden eingegebene Cent-Beträge nicht mit gutgeschrieben. Dies tritt sowhl bei der Verwendung des Punkts als auch das Kommas als Dezimaltrennzeichen auf. In der Vorschau der Gutschein E-Mail wird noch der korrekte Betrag angezeigt, sodass der Shopbetreiber den Fehler erst nach dem Versand feststellen kann.

Schritte zum Reproduzieren des Problems:

  • Aufruf von 'Gutscheine > Gutschein E-Mail'
  • Trage einen 'Wert' mit Nachkommastellen ein, z.B. 13,37 oder 13.37
  • Klicke in der Maske auf 'E-Mail senden'
  • erwartetes Ergebnis: in der Vorschau wird 'Wert: 13.37' angezeigt
  • tatsächliches Ergebnis: in der Vorschau wird 'Wert: 13.37' angezeigt
  • Klicke auf 'E-Mail senden' in der Vorschau
  • erwartetes Ergebnis:
    In der E-Mail wird Gutscheinwert: 13,37 bzw. 13,37 EUR aufgeführt
    unter 'Gutscheine -> Guscheine versandt' wird 'Betrag versandt: 13,37EUR' angezeigt

  • tatsächliches Ergebnis:
    In der E-Mail wird 'Gutscheinwert: 13' aufgeführt
    unter 'Gutscheine -> Gutscheine versandt' wird 'Betrag versandt: 13,00EUR' angezeigt


When sending a gift voucher decimal values are cut off. This happens when either period or comma are used as a decimal separator. The preview of the e-mail still displays the correct amount, so the shop operator can spot the error only after the mail has been sent.

Steps to reproduce the problem:

  • call Vouchers -> Mail Gift Voucher
  • enter an 'Amount' with decimal places, for instance 13,37 or 13.37
  • click 'Send Email' to open preview
  • expected result: 'Amount 13.37' is displayed
  • actual result: 'Amount 13.37' is displayed
  • click 'Send Email' to send Gift Voucher with values displayed within preview
  • expected result:
    Voucher value: 13,37 or 13,37 EUR is displayed within the email
    'Vouchers -> Gift Vouchers' sent displays 'Amount Sent: 13,37EUR'

  • actual result:
    'Voucher value: 13' is displayed within the email
    'Vouchers -> Gift Vouchers sent' displays 'Amount Sent: 13,00EUR'


Dateien

gutscheinmail01.png (5,33 KB) gutscheinmail01.png Vorschau zeigt korrekten Gutschein-Wert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ail00.png (33,8 KB) gutscheinmail00.png Eingabe eines Gutscheinwerts mit Punkt als Dezimaltrenner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ail02.png (39,4 KB) gutscheinmail02.png E-Mail gibt Gutschein-Wert ohne Nachkommastellen an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ail03.png (36,4 KB) gutscheinmail03.png Unter Gutscheine versandt wurde der Wert ohne Nachkommastellen angelegt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ail05.png (4,28 KB) gutscheinmail05.png Vorschau zeigt korrekten Gutschein-Wert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ail06.png (42 KB) gutscheinmail06.png E-Mail gibt Gutschein-Wert ohne Nachkommastellen an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ail04.png (30,4 KB) gutscheinmail04.png Eingabe eines Gutscheinwerts mit Komma als Dezimaltrenner Jan-Olof Kratzke, 27.11.2020 10:44
gutscheinmail07.png (39,8 KB) gutscheinmail07.png Unter Gutscheine versandt wurde der Wert ohne Nachkommastellen angelegt Jan-Olof Kratzke, 27.11.2020 10:44


Zugehörige Tickets

Beziehung mit GX-Entwicklung - GX-Bug #67857: If you choose "€" as Symbol left for the default currency, then every created Mail Voucher has the value of 0ErledigtJulian Heckmann

Aktionen
Aktionen

Auch abrufbar als: Atom PDF